cp2102 Silicon Laboratories, cp2102 Datasheet

no-image

cp2102

Manufacturer Part Number
cp2102
Description
Single-chip Usb To Uart Bridge
Manufacturer
Silicon Laboratories
Datasheet

Available stocks

Company
Part Number
Manufacturer
Quantity
Price
Part Number:
CP2102
Manufacturer:
SILABS
Quantity:
20 000
Part Number:
cp2102-GM
Manufacturer:
SiliconL
Quantity:
45 176
Part Number:
cp2102-GM
Manufacturer:
TI
Quantity:
418
Part Number:
cp2102-GM
Manufacturer:
ST
0
Part Number:
cp2102-GM
Manufacturer:
SILICON
Quantity:
20 000
Company:
Part Number:
cp2102-GM
Quantity:
6
Company:
Part Number:
cp2102-GM
Quantity:
6
Part Number:
cp2102-GM//-GMR
Manufacturer:
SILICON
Quantity:
5 761
Part Number:
cp2102-GMR
Manufacturer:
MAXIM
Quantity:
2 300
Part Number:
cp2102-GMR
Manufacturer:
SiliconL
Quantity:
12 000
Part Number:
cp2102-GMR
Manufacturer:
SILICON
Quantity:
100
Part Number:
cp2102-GMR
Manufacturer:
SILICON
Quantity:
150
Part Number:
cp2102-GMR
Manufacturer:
SILICON LABS/芯科
Quantity:
20 000
Part Number:
cp2102-GMR
0
Company:
Part Number:
cp2102-GMR
Quantity:
30 000
Company:
Part Number:
cp2102-GMR
Quantity:
1 016 748
Company:
Part Number:
cp2102-GMR
Quantity:
1 016 748
S
Single-Chip USB to UART Data Transfer
USB Function Controller
Asynchronous Serial Data BUS (UART)
Rev. 1.2 3/07
CONNECTOR
INGLE
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
USB
- Data bits: 5, 6, 7, and 8
- Stop bits: 1, 1.5, and 2
- Parity: odd, even, mark, space, no parity
VBUS
Integrated USB transceiver; no external resistors
Integrated clock; no external crystal required
Integrated 1024-Byte EEPROM for vendor ID, product
On-chip power-on reset circuit
On-chip voltage regulator: 3.3 V output
100% pin and software compatible with CP2101
USB Specification 2.0 compliant; full-speed (12 Mbps)
USB suspend states supported via SUSPEND pins
All handshaking and modem interface signals
Data formats supported:
Baud rates: 300 bps to 1 Mbits
576 Byte receive buffer; 640 byte transmit buffer
Hardware or X-On/X-Off handshaking supported
Event character support
Line break transmission
GND
required
ID, serial number, power descriptor, release number,
and product description strings
D+
D-
1
4
-C
HIP
D1 D2 D3
7
6
8
5
4
REGIN
USB
VBUS
GND
VDD
D+
D-
Transceiver
TO
IN
USB
Regulator
Copyright © 2007 by Silicon Laboratories
Voltage
Figure 1. Example System Diagram
OUT
UART B
EEPROM
1024B
Oscillator
48 MHz
3.3 V
USB Function
Controller
Buffer
640B
CP2102
TX
RIDGE
Buffer
576B
Virtual COM Port Device Drivers
USBXpress™ Direct Driver Support
Example Applications
Supply Voltage
Package
Ordering Part Number
Temperature Range: –40 to +85 °C
RX
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
Works with Existing COM Port PC Applications
Royalty-Free Distribution License
Windows Vista/XP/Server 2003/2000/98SE
Mac OS-X / OS-9
Linux
Royalty-Free Distribution License
Windows Vista/XP/Server 2003/2000
Windows CE 5.0 and 4.2
Upgrade of RS-232 legacy devices to USB
Cellular phone USB interface cable
PDA USB interface cable
USB to RS-232 serial adapter
Self-powered: 3.0 to 3.6 V
USB bus powered: 4.0 to 5.25 V
Lead free 28-pin QFN (5 x 5 mm)
CP2102-GM
UART
SUSPEND
SUSPEND
RST
DCD
DSR
RXD
C P 2 1 0 2
DTR
TXD
RTS
CTS
RI
9
12
11
2
1
28
27
26
25
24
23
VDD
External RS-232
(to external circuitry
for USB suspend
states)
UART circuitry
transceiver or
CP2102

Related parts for cp2102

cp2102 Summary of contents

Page 1

... EEPROM Buffer Buffer Figure 1. Example System Diagram Copyright © 2007 by Silicon Laboratories VDD 9 RST (to external circuitry 12 for USB suspend SUSPEND states) 11 SUSPEND DCD External RS-232 transceiver or 28 DTR UART circuitry 27 DSR UART 26 TXD 25 RXD 24 RTS 23 CTS CP2102 ...

Page 2

... CP2102 N : OTES 2 Rev. 1.2 ...

Page 3

... USB Function Controller and Transceiver .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 11 6. Asynchronous Serial Data Bus (UART) Interface .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 12 7. Internal EEPROM .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 12 8. CP2101 Device Drivers .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.13 8.1. Virtual COM Port Drivers .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 13 8.2. USBXpress Drivers .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 13 8.3. Driver Customization .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.13 8.4. Driver Certification .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.13 9. Voltage Regulator .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.14 10. Relevant Application Notes .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 16 Document Change List .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.17 Contact Information .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.18 Rev. 1.2 CP2102 Page 3 ...

Page 4

... Royalty-free Virtual COM Port (VCP) device drivers provided by Silicon Laboratories allow a CP2102-based product to appear as a COM port to PC applications. The CP2102 UART interface implements all RS-232 signals, including control and handshaking signals, so existing system firmware does not need to be modified. In many existing RS-232 designs, all that is required to update the design from RS-232 to USB is to replace the RS-232 level-translator with the CP2102 ...

Page 5

... I = –10 µA V – 0 –10 mA — 8.5 mA — µA — — OL 2.0 — — Conditions 0 Rev. 1.2 CP2102 Typ Max Units 3.3 3.6 V — — 80 100 µA — 200 228 µA — +85 °C Typ Max UNITS — — — — ...

Page 6

... Data Carrier Detect control input (active low Ring Indicator control input (active low) This pin is driven high when the CP2102 enters the USB suspend state. This pin is driven low when the CP2102 enters the USB suspend state. These pins should be left unconnected or tied to V Rev. 1.2 Description Section 9 ...

Page 7

... GND DCD GND 3 CP2102 D+ 4 Top View GND REGIN 7 Figure 2. QFN-28 Pinout Diagram (Top View Rev. 1.2 CP2102 7 ...

Page 8

... CP2102 Bottom View DETAIL Side View DETAIL Figure 3. QFN-28 Package Drawing Rev. 1.2 Table 6. QFN-28 Package Dimensions MM MIN TYP MAX A 0.80 0.90 1. 0.02 0. 0.65 1.00 A3 — 0.25 — b 0.18 0.23 0.30 D — 5.00 — D2 2.90 3.15 3.35 E — ...

Page 9

... Optional GND Connection L 0.20 mm 0.30 mm 0.50 mm 0.35 mm 0.10 mm 0.85 mm Figure 4. Typical QFN-28 Landing Diagram Top View E2 E Rev. 1.2 CP2102 0. ...

Page 10

... CP2102 0.50 mm 0.60 mm 0. 0.20 mm 0.30 mm 0.50 mm 0.35 mm 0.10 mm 0.85 mm Figure 5. Typical QFN-28 Solder Paste Diagram 10 Top View 0.60 mm 0.30 mm 0. Rev. 1.2 0.85 mm ...

Page 11

... USB Function Controller and Transceiver The Universal Serial Bus function controller in the CP2102 is a USB 2.0 compliant full-speed device with integrated transceiver and on-chip matching and pull-up resistors. The USB function controller manages all data transfers between the USB and the UART as well as command requests generated by the USB host controller and commands for controlling the function of the UART ...

Page 12

... Silicon Laboratories VID also recommended to customize the serial number if the OEM application is one in which it is possible for multiple CP2102-based devices to be connected to the same PC. The internal EEPROM is programmed via the USB. This allows the OEM's USB configuration data and serial number to be written to the CP2102 on-board during the manufacturing and testing process ...

Page 13

... Product Description String 8. CP2102 Device Drivers There are two sets of device drivers available for the CP2102 devices: the Virtual COM Port (VCP) drivers and the USBXpress Direct Access drivers. Only one set of drivers is necessary to interface with the device. The latest drivers are available at http://www.silabs.com/products/microcontroller/downloads.asp. ...

Page 14

... CP2102 9. Voltage Regulator The CP2102 includes an on-chip voltage regulator. This allows the CP2102 to be configured as either a USB bus-powered device or a USB self-powered device. These configurations are shown in Figure 7 and Figure 8. When enabled, the 3 V voltage regulator output appears on the V devices ...

Page 15

... Figure 8. Configuration 2: USB Self-Powered VBUS From VBUS REGIN V From Power Net Figure 9. Configuration 3: USB Self-Powered, Regulator Bypassed CP2102 VBUS Sense Voltage Regulator (REG0 Out CP2102 VBUS Sense Voltage Regulator (REG0 Out Rev. 1.2 CP2102 Device Power Net Device Power Net 15 ...

Page 16

... CP2102 10. Relevant Application Notes The following Application Notes are applicable to the CP2102. The latest versions of these application notes and their accompanying software are available at: http://www.silabs.com/products/microcontroller/applications.asp. AN144: CP210x Device Customization Guide. This application note describes how to use the AN144 software to configure the USB parameters on the CP2102 devices. ...

Page 17

... Changed MLP to QFN throughout. Revision 1.1 to Revision 1.2 Added additional supported operating systems on page 1. Changed VDD conditions of Tables 2 and 3 from a minimum of 2.7 to 3.0 V. Updated typical and max Supply Current number in Table 2. Removed tantalum requirement in Figure 6. Consolidated Sections 8 and 9. Added Section "10. Relevant Application Notes" on page 16. Rev. 1.2 CP2102 17 ...

Page 18

... CP2102 C I ONTACT NFORMATION Silicon Laboratories Inc. 400 West Cesar Chavez Austin, TX 78701 Tel: 1+(512) 416-8500 Fax: 1+(512) 416-9669 Toll Free: 1+(877) 444-3032 Email: MCUtools@silabs.com Internet: www.silabs.com The information in this document is believed to be accurate in all respects at the time of publication but is subject to change without notice. ...

Related keywords